How Does A Video Capture Card Work?

A video capture card works by taking in video footage and converting it into data that your PC is then able to read and display. Video capture cards are essentially comprised of one or several input jacks for receiving the video, a computer chip which reads and converts the incoming footage, and a buffer for data storage. Depending on the kind of input jack, a video capture card may accept video from digital sources only, analogue sources such as DVD players, or both.

Video capture cards come in two main forms: internal and external. Internal cards are plugged into the standard PCI or PCI Express slots on the PC’s motherboard, whilst an external video capture box connects to the computer via USB. External capture cards have the advantage of being portable, whereas internal cards are ideal for more intensive use; an internally installed video capture card enables you to save your video footage without putting too much pressure on the CPU and GPU. Whether it’s capturing a legendary gaming moment or saving and storing your own YouTube footage, a video capture card opens up a world of possibilities. For film buffs, a card with analogue input can be used to receive and convert video from a DVD player, allowing you to store all your favourite movies on your PC. Alternatively, a video capture box is ideal for preserving those incredible gaming scenes that have to be seen to be believed; with the right software, you can even add commentary before sharing them with your friends. Video capture cards can also double up as TV capture cards; by means of a tuner, they enable the computer to receive TV signals—ideal for both watching and saving streamed material, all from the comfort of your laptop or PC.
